NB 16MnNiMo Heat Treatments
- Forgings should be delivered in the heat treated state and various materials should be heat treated as follows:
- Austenitizing at a temperature between 850°C and 900°C;
- Water quench;
- Tempering at temperature min. 630°C. - The heat treatment, should include the following process:
- austenitizing at a temperature between 850°C and 925°C,
- quenching by immersion in water,
- tempering at a temperature selected so as to obtain the required properties, followed by still air cooling.
Holding temperature for tempering shall be between 635°C and 665°C. Holding time at that temperature shall depend on the thickness of the plate, on the minimum basis of half an hour per 25 mm of thickness.
